官方资源(首选,权威且免费)
Microsoft 官方提供了大量高质量、免费的视频教程,是学习 Visual Studio 的最佳起点。

Microsoft Learn 官方文档与教程
这是微软官方的学习平台,内容与 Visual Studio 的更新同步最快,质量最高。
- 网址: https://learn.microsoft.com/zh-cn/visualstudio/
- 特点:
- 权威性: 内容由微软官方团队编写和审核。
- 结构化: 提供了清晰的学习路径和模块化教程。
- 交互式: 包含在线代码示例和交互式教程,可以边学边练。
- 多语言: 支持中文,内容全面。
- 推荐学习路径:
- 初学者入门: 从“安装和设置”开始,然后学习“IDE 基础”、“编辑器功能”等。
- 按语言/平台学习: 选择您想开发的方向,如“使用 C# 创建 .NET 控制台应用”、“使用 Python 创建 Web 应用”、“使用 C++ 创建桌面应用”等。
Visual Studio 官方 YouTube 频道
这个频道是视频学习的宝库,包含了官方发布的教学视频、功能介绍、技巧分享等。
- 网址: https://www.youtube.com/c/VisualStudio
- 特点:
- 视频形式: 更直观地展示操作过程。
- 内容丰富: 涵盖新功能发布、深度技术解析、开发者访谈等。
- 中英双语: 大部分视频都有官方中文配音或字幕。
- "Visual Studio" 播放列表: 官方整理好的系列教程。
- "C# 教程" 播放列表: 从零开始学习 C# 和 .NET。
- "Visual Studio 2025 新功能" 系列视频: 了解最新版本的强大功能。
中文视频教程平台(适合国内用户,有中文母语讲解)
这些平台上的教程由国内优秀的讲师或机构制作,语言更接地气,节奏更适合国内学习者。
Bilibili (B站)
B站是程序员学习的“圣地”,有大量免费且高质量的教学视频。

-
特点:
- 免费资源多: 绝大多数教程都是免费的。
- 社区活跃: 可以在评论区提问,有热心网友和UP主解答。
- 内容全面: 涵盖从入门到进阶的各个领域。
-
推荐UP主/关键词搜索:
-
搜索关键词:
Visual Studio 入门VS 2025 教程C# 入门教程ASP.NET Core 教程C++ Visual Studio 教程Python Visual Studio
-
推荐UP主 (请自行搜索其最新内容):
(图片来源网络,侵删)- 野火电子: 嵌入式开发相关教程非常出名,其 C# 和 .NET 教程也做得很好。
- 雷丰阳 (尚硅谷): 尚硅谷的讲师,其 .NET Core 系列教程在圈内口碑极佳,非常系统。
- 黑马程序员: 提供系统的全套课程,从基础到项目实战,非常全面。
- 很多个人技术博主: 也会发布高质量的 Visual Studio 使用技巧和项目实战视频。
-
CSDN / 腾讯课堂 / 慕课网
这些是专业的IT在线教育平台,提供系统化的课程。
- CSDN学院: 有大量免费和付费的系列课程,可以跟着一个完整的项目从头学到尾。
- 腾讯课堂 / 慕课网: 课程质量普遍较高,通常由专业讲师或机构制作,有完整的课程体系和配套资料,部分课程需要付费,但内容更精炼、更系统。
国际知名视频平台(英文资源,质量顶尖)
如果您英文不错,这些平台是提升技术深度的绝佳选择。
Pluralsight
被誉为程序员的“Netflix”,拥有海量的、由行业专家制作的高质量课程。
- 网址: https://www.pluralsight.com/
- 特点:
- 课程质量极高: 课程结构严谨,内容深入浅出。
- 路径清晰: 提供完整的“学习路径”(Learning Path),帮助你系统地掌握一项技能。
- 需要付费: 但通常有免费试用。
- 推荐课程:
- 搜索 "Visual Studio Fundamentals" (Visual Studio 基础)。
- 搜索 "C# Learning Path" 或 ".NET Learning Path"。
freeCodeCamp
完全免费的非营利性学习平台,课程内容非常扎实,且完全免费。
- 网址: https://www.freecodecamp.org/ (有YouTube频道)
- 特点:
- 完全免费: 所有课程和认证都是免费的。
- 项目驱动: 学习过程中会完成多个实战项目。
- 社区支持: 拥有庞大的全球社区。
- 推荐课程:
其 YouTube 频道有完整的 "C# and .NET Core for Beginners" 等系列教程。
YouTube 上的个人频道
除了微软官方频道,还有很多顶尖的开发者分享他们的知识。
- 推荐频道:
- Programming with Mosh: Mosh 的讲解非常清晰易懂,是全球最受欢迎的编程讲师之一,他的 C# 和 .NET 系列教程是经典之作。
- Fireship: 以快节奏、信息量大的短视频为主,适合了解新技术和最佳实践。
- The Net Ninja: 提供大量系列教程,从入门到进阶,内容覆盖面广。
学习建议与路径规划
为了让你更高效地学习,这里提供一个建议的学习路径:
IDE 基础入门 (1-2周)
- 目标: 熟悉 Visual Studio 的界面和基本操作。
- 安装与激活: 如何下载和安装 Visual Studio Community (免费版)。
- 界面概览: 认识菜单栏、工具栏、解决方案资源管理器、属性窗口、错误列表等。
- 项目创建: 学习创建不同类型的项目(如控制台应用、类库、Web应用)。
- 代码编辑: 学习代码编辑器的基本功能,如代码着色、智能提示、代码片段、格式化等。
- 调试入门: 学习设置断点、逐语句调试、查看变量值。
- 推荐资源: Microsoft Learn 的 "Visual Studio IDE" 部分,或 B站上的
VS 2025 入门系列视频。
选择一门语言,进行项目实战 (1-3个月)
- 目标: 掌握一门主流语言,并使用 Visual Studio 完成一个完整的项目。
- 选择方向:
- 后端开发: 选择 C# 和 .NET,这是微软的亲儿子,与 Visual Studio 结合得天衣无缝。
- 桌面应用: 选择 C# (.NET WinUI/WPF) 或 C++ (MFC/Qt)。
- Web前端: 学习 HTML, CSS, JavaScript,并使用 Visual Studio 的 Web开发工具。
- 数据科学/脚本: 选择 Python,Visual Studio 对 Python 的支持也非常好。
- 学习所选语言的基础语法。
- 学习使用 NuGet (包管理器) 引入第三方库。
- 学习使用 Git 进行版本控制(Visual Studio 集成了 Git)。
- 跟着一个完整的教程,从零开始构建一个项目,博客系统、待办事项应用、小工具等。
- 推荐资源:
- C#/.NET: B站 雷丰阳 的 .NET Core 教程,或 Programming with Mosh 的 C# 课程。
- Python: freeCodeCamp 或 Coursera 上的 Python 入门课程,然后在 VS 中实践。
高级技巧与效率提升 (持续学习)
- 目标: 成为 Visual Studio 高手,大幅提升开发效率。
- 高级调试: 探索监视
